## Artifact signing — Spokeshift

All Spokeshift rebalancing-tool builds must be signed before publishing to the fleet depot. CI signs automatically on tagged builds; manual releases are forbidden. Verify any artifact with `spokeshift verify` before deployment to the hub controllers. The signing key currently registered with the depot is shown below.

deploy key for kajof-fajop: bky6_gDHw9Q

**Mgmt Meeting Minutes — Retiring the Brightline Range**

Quick recap for sales leads at Fenholt Supplies: we agreed to retire the Brightline fixture range by year-end. Remaining stock moves to clearance pricing next month, and accounts on standing orders get migrated to the Lumetta range. Trade-in incentives were approved in principle. The confidential note on next steps sits just below.

board note of bajof-bajeg: The pricing group signed off on a budget of $13.4 million for Project Sildor. The renewal with Lamixek Holdings closes at $48.9 million a year, 49 percent above the last contract.

Subject: On-call heads up — tax-rate cache

Welcome to the rotation. The Quillbridge tax-rate lookup cache occasionally serves stale rates after a jurisdiction update; symptoms are mismatched totals in checkout logs. Flushing the cache resolves it within minutes. The flush procedure and escalation criteria are documented on the page below.

wiki page, fahop-hawip: https://sentry.norvasys.local/ticket

**Ticket IDX-977: Signature verification failing on autocomplete index push**

Context for new team members: the Finchley autocomplete index has been slow lately, so we rebuilt it on the new shard layout. The push to staging failed signature verification because the uploader still references the retired key from last quarter's rotation. The index data itself is fine. Fix is to update the uploader config and retry; expect about twenty minutes for the full index sync. The uploader must be configured with the key shown here.

rollout seal: bky4_x7Gc